Common NameALPHA-PROPYLPHENETHYL ALCOHOL
ClassSmall Molecule
Description(±)-1-Phenyl-2-pentanol is a flavouring agent

Chemical Taxonomy
Description belongs to the class of organic compounds known as benzene and substituted derivatives. These are aromatic compounds containing one monocyclic ring system consisting of benzene.
